Energy Select Sector Index
The Energy Select Sector Index (IXE) is a modified market capitalization-based index intended to track the movements of companies that are components of the S&P 500 and are involved in the development or production of energy products. Energy companies in the Index develop and produce crude oil and natural gas and provide drilling and other energy related services. The Index, which serves as the benchmark for the Energy Select Sector SPDR Fund (XLE), was established with a value of 250.00 on June 30, 1998. Each stock in the S&P 500 is allocated to only one Select Sector Index, and the combined companies of the nine Select Sector Indexes represent all of the companies in the S&P 500.
